The Chief of Staff, Guillermo Francos, confirmed this Saturday that the national government will veto the laws recently approved by the Senate, including the increase in retirements and the declaration of emergency on disability. In statements to Radio Rivadavia, the official argued that these measures would compromise the fiscal balance, one of the central pillars of the economic policy promoted by President Javier Milei.
